ZIP 23851 and ZIP 23860 are ZIP Code areas in Virginia.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 23860 has the higher population (31,432 vs 13,481 in ZIP 23851). ZIP 23851 has the higher median household income ($73,333 vs $55,104 in ZIP 23860). ZIP 23851 has the higher median home value ($222,700 vs $187,800 in ZIP 23860).
